Robert Brown
Robert Brown was a Scottish botanist whose meticulous observations profoundly shaped our understanding of biology. Notably, he documented the erratic movement of pollen grains in water, now recognized as Brownian motion. Henri Becquerel
Henri Becquerel was a French physicist whose meticulous experimentation led to the groundbreaking discovery of natural radioactivity. Studying uranium salts, he observed spontaneous emissions of energy without external stimulation – a phenomenon that revolutionized physics and chemistry.
